According to reports, they blocked the Murtala Muhammed Access Plaza with placards.
Some of the protesters marched from Computer Village via Along Bus Stop to the airport.
They obstructed traffic and delayed vehicles from accessing the airport through the plaza.
It was gathered the protest began at 10 am.

They blocked motorists trying to access the local airport by setting up their stand at the Murtala Mohammed Airport Access Plaza, thereby causing gridlock at the roundabout.
Many intended travelers had to find alternative means of transportation.
Singing songs of solidarity, they carried placards with inscriptions such as “iPhone no be gun”, “SARSMUSTEND”, “Chibuike Amana deserves justice”.
Several motorists, who expressed their frustration at the gridlock, said they have been stuck in the traffic for close to two hours.
